Character Development

Is the student creative in his/her development and delivery of the their character.

Surpasses Expectations

25 points
*Character objective and motivation is well-defined.
*Depth and range of choices is expansive.
Meets Expectations

20 points
*Character's motivation is somewhat defined.
*Depth and range of choices is adequate.
Falls Short of Expectations

18 points
*Character objective and motivation is lacking.
*There is little depth or range of choices.
Far Below Expectations

15 points
*Student is doing little more than walking around the stage lip-syncing.
*Student has no regard for character development
Movement

Is the body utilized to the student's utmost ability to aid in development of character's intent and delivery of lines/music?

Surpasses Expectations

25 points
*Student employs phenomenal use of physicality to enhance character with body movements and facial expressions.
*Student uses a variety of blocking to add interest to the piece.
*Student's movements always reflect purpose.
*Any choreographed moments were succinct and well executed.
Meets Expectations

20 points
*Student employs appropriate use of physicality to enhance character with body movement and facial expression.
*Student uses an appropriate amount of blocking to add interest to the piece.
*Student's movements usually reflect purpose.
*Any choreographed moments were sufficient and executed effectively.
Falls Short of Expectations

18 points
*Student strives to employ appropriate use of physicality, but overall affect is flimsy
*Student's movements rarely reflect purpose.
*Execution of choreography is inconsistent.
Far Below Expectations

15 points
*Student employs little to no physicality in scene.
*Student's moves are without purpose.
*Recollection of choreography is minimal to non existent.
Focus

Does the student retain focus (stay in character) throughout the entire performance?

Surpasses Expectations

25 points
*Student stays completely immersed in their character throughout the entire performance.
*Student never breaks focus, even during missed lines/cues or mistakes in the music.
Meets Expectations

20 points
*Student weaves in and out of character slightly throughout performance.
*Student subtly breaks focus when possible distractions occur.
Falls Short of Expectations

18 points
*Student never truly immerses enough into their character to produce any kind of believability.
*Student's focus is easily broken; attention wavers often.
Far Below Expectations

15 points
*Student makes little to no attempt at staying in any type of character.
*Student lacks focus and seems unprepared.
Ensemble Contribution

Graded performance is part of a scene, this is the student's ability to work with others.

Surpasses Expectations

25 points
*Student's awareness and willingness to connect to other ensmble members is very apparent.
*Student's ability to work as part of a team is extraordinary.
Meets Expectations

20 points
*Student's awareness and willingness to connect to other ensemble members is acceptable.
*Student's ability to work as part of a team is sufficient
Falls Short of Expectations

18 points
*Student's awareness and willingness to connect to other ensemble members is weak.
*Student seems to have little concept of how to work as a team.
Far Below Expectations

15 points
*Student's awareness and empathy towards other ensemble members is non existent.
*Student has no concept of how to work as an ensemble member.
